Transaction 59ec73e65d37cd25452713e4fb653b7db8eb04bcbb25fec80b3f7020a22b5a7b
1 Input
1 Output
-
59ec73e65d37cd25452713e4fb653b7db8eb04bcbb25fec80b3f7020a22b5a7b:0
- value
- 76099
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b845008590ba7e6b94371f36137370158a02bdd
- address
- bc1qewz9qzzepwn7dw2rw8ekzdehq9v2q27a95r0zy